Kwara United Aims To Improve Records
Kwara United was aiming to continue their impressive run of form in the Nigerian Professional Foot-ball League when they took on Sunshine Stars of Akure on yesterday.
Kwara United was going into the game at the back of four games unbeaten run, including three wins and a draw, results that took them to third position on the standings.
The match was scheduled to be played at the Ondo State Sports Complex in Akure, a ground the Harmony Boys had tasted defeats several times.
Sunshine Stars and Kwara United had met 17 times in competitive football with the Biffo’s team losing 8 and won 4, while the remai-ning 5 meetings ended in a draw.
Speaking ahead of the match, Kwara United gaffer Abdullahi Biffo, said he was positive that his wards would improve their records against Sunshine Stars in their backyard.
“The morale of my players is high and we are in Akure to beat Sunshine Stars this time around, because we need the three points more than them.
“We respect Sunshine Stars as one of the best teams in Nigeria, but they won’t get that on Sunday on the pitch against my players,” Biffo stated confidently.
